Exposure Compensation
Exposure compensation is used to alter exposure from the value
suggested by the camera, making pictures brighter or darker.
In exposure mode
h, only the exposure information shown in the
electronic analog exposure display is affected; shutter speed and
aperture do not change.
To choose a value for exposure
compensation, press the
E button and
rotate the main command dial until the
desired value is displayed in the control
panel or viewfinder.
